正文
css未知宽高的居中,div盒子 宽度未知,怎么实现宽高比21
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
不知道元素大小时css如何实现垂直水平居中(代码)
未知高度的元素,文字垂直居中是比较难实现的,得用js实现,不过可以取个巧用css的padding属性实现。
CSS实现水平垂直居中对齐在CSS中实现水平居中,会比较简单。
}div{ text-align:center;} 假设p在div内部,要让p居中先给外层元素设置text-align:center,这个意思是让div里面的内联元素居中,然后将p变成内联元素,即可。
用CSS实现元素的水平居中,比较简单,可以设置text-align center,或者设置 margin-left:auto; margin-right:auto 之类的即可。 主要麻烦的地方还是在垂直居中的处理上,所以接下来主要考虑垂直方向上的居中实现。
如何使用css让一个未知宽高的盒子垂直水平居中?
这篇文章给大家分享的内容是关于css如何实现不知道大小的元素的垂直水平居中(代码),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。
CSS:重点:父元素position定位为relative,子元素position定位为absolute。水平居中同理。calc居中要减多少要结合到自己的宽高设置多少再进行计算。
让层垂直居中于浏览器窗口 其实解决的思路是这样的:首们需要position:absolute;绝对定位。而层的定位点,使用外补丁margin负值的方法。负值的大小为层自身宽度高度除以二。如:一个层宽度是400,高度是300。
用CSS实现元素的水平居中,比较简单,可以设置text-align center,或者设置 margin-left:auto; margin-right:auto 之类的即可。 主要麻烦的地方还是在垂直居中的处理上,所以接下来主要考虑垂直方向上的居中实现。
未知高度的元素,文字垂直居中是比较难实现的,得用js实现,不过可以取个巧用css的padding属性实现。
css宽高自适应的div元素以及如何垂直居中
1、重点:父容器高度和子元素line-height一样的数值,内容中的行内元素就会垂直居中。
2、}div{ text-align:center;} 假设p在div内部,要让p居中先给外层元素设置text-align:center,这个意思是让div里面的内联元素居中,然后将p变成内联元素,即可。
3、CSS网页布局DIV水平居中的各种方法 单行垂直居中 如果一个容器中只有一行文字,对它实现居中相对比较简单,我们只需要设置它的实际高度height和所在行的高度line-height相等即可。
4、这里为了显示特意给div设置了边框。接下来我们就在div中添加内容,如下图所示,运行后你会发现内容偏向于左上角。下面我们给div设置水平居中,如下图所示,并且设置行高为div的高度,你会发现它水平垂直居中了。
5、备注:这里DIV的宽高计算都遵循盒模型原理,计算方法同上。方法三:思路:利用图片的margin属性将图片水平居中,利用DIV的padding属性将图片垂直居中。
css子元素如何在父元素中居中
子元素,父级元素都是块级元素的时候,子级元素{margin:0 auto}。需要注意的是当子级元素的position为非默认及relative时,这种设置会失效。如p等标签中内的文字内容水平居中:使用{text-Align:center}。
父DIV与子DIV都要设置宽度,我是随便设的,你可以根据需要来分别调整。图中子DIV之间的间距以及子DIV与父DIV之间的间距需要通过margin属性来控制,如果不明白的话,你可以把具体的数值告诉我,我帮你设置。
原理就是通过css3布局属性flex将子容器转换为flex item情况,然后通过justify-content属性来达到居中。这种方式需要给父容器设置这两种属性。缺点就是css3属性,有浏览器兼容问题。
display: table-cell 由于单元格可以轻易的实现水平和垂直居中,所以可以把父元素容器模拟成单元格元素,通过样式text-align:center以及vertical-align:middle来达到一样的效果。
CSS:重点:在父元素中设置相对定位position: relative,子元素设置绝对定位 position: absolute;top和left相对父元素的50%,与其搭配的 transformse: translate(-50% , -50%)表示X轴和Y轴方向水平居中。
给所有子元素添加 float: left ,给父元素加 clearfix 类,清除浮动 html:css:将内联元素外部的块级元素的 text-align 设置为 center ,即可实现内联元素( inline 、 inline-block )的水平居中。
如何对未知高度的图片设置垂直居中
1、②点开查看下“环绕文字”可以看出,默认一般是:嵌入型 点击:②中的“位置”当我们鼠标移至框选处,word编辑区域就能看到图片垂直居中了,我们点下去,就是选中该设置了。
2、图片宽高固定,这种情况很简单。水平居中:就在图片的css中加 dispaly:block;margin:0 auto;垂直居中:自己算出(div的高度-图片的高度)/2,得到margin-top值即可。图片高度未知,这个布局比较难实现。
3、鼠标左键选中要调整位置的图片。点击工具栏的开始-排列。点击对齐。我们可以看到大量的对齐方式,点击相对于幻灯片。在里面可以根据需要选择左对齐,右对齐,靠上对齐,靠下对齐。
关于css未知宽高的居中和div盒子 宽度未知,怎么实现宽高比21的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。